Transaction 66a2f332082110edcb60af345026b4eab6f2b53af68a9973e052109c3b275b84

1 Input
2 Outputs
  • 66a2f332082110edcb60af345026b4eab6f2b53af68a9973e052109c3b275b84:0
  • value  2351446
    address  3GMHAY1E3c353QTy3imvttwDE1cgfaUzPK
  • 66a2f332082110edcb60af345026b4eab6f2b53af68a9973e052109c3b275b84:1
  • value  11359384
    address  bc1q7ctqaplqr9q6s6lka4fwj6m5chvgrapf5hclvp